Key Responsibilities Professional Learning and Growth: Participate in yearly professional development, including faculty and grade-level meetings, job-embedded professional development, and cluster meetings. Student Engagement: Design and deliver engaging visual arts lessons that promote student participation, creativity, and academic achievement. Essential Content: Develop common core-aligned lesson plans and unit plans that advance students toward grade-level standards and expectations. Academic Ownership: Foster a classroom environment where students take ownership of their learning, provide meaningful feedback, and engage in critical thinking and problem-solving. Demonstration of Learning: Assess student progress through various methods, including observations, written work, and project-based evaluations. Teacher Accountability: Participate in TAP evaluations, observations, and feedback sessions to continuously improve teaching practices. Qualifications and Requirements To be considered for this role, you should possess: A Bachelor's Degree in Education or a related field. A valid Louisiana Teaching Certificate (preferred). Two years of teaching experience (preferred). A proven record of high student achievement and academic growth. A passion for teaching and a commitment to our mission and educational model. Openness to professional learning, feedback, and continuous improvement. Skills and Competencies To excel in this role, you will need: Strong knowledge of visual arts education and curriculum design. Excellent classroom management and teaching skills. Ability to differentiate instruction and cater to diverse learning needs. Effective communication and interpersonal skills. Proficiency in using technology to support teaching and learning.
